Blow-Fill-Pack Integration for Water Bottling Lines
The three headline machines run with different cycles and stop patterns. Integration defines how the line absorbs those differences without turning every short stop into lost packs.

Why can individually fast machines still form a slow line?
Review point 01
Normalize the rating basis
Compare each machine using the same reference bottle, net operating period and acceptance boundary. Record whether output is instantaneous, test-average or sustained good production.
- Reference bottle and neck finish
- Approved preform and cap
- Pack pattern
- Test duration and stop treatment
Review point 02
Give each interface a recovery strategy
A conveyor is not automatically a useful buffer. Define what happens when the filler is starved, the labeler is blocked or the packer stops cycling.
- Minimum and maximum accumulation
- Controlled slow-down behavior
- Restart sequence
- Reject and re-entry policy
Review point 03
Prove the connected behavior
A line test should include normal running, controlled stops and restart observation. The evidence should show both gross counts and accepted packs.
- Stop log by cause
- Good-bottle and good-pack counts
- Pressure and supply observations
- Open-item list with owners

Should the blower always be rated above the filler?
A design margin may be useful, but it must be evaluated with the approved bottle, blowing conditions, maintenance plan and actual filler demand.
Can more conveyor always solve synchronization problems?
No. Additional length only helps when container stability, control zoning and recovery logic make the space usable as accumulation.
